| Abstract | The Hope-Through-Sharing Program lets patients waiting for a kidney to jump ahead of others on the list of a friend or relative, who is not a suitable match for the patient, donates a kidney to another recipient with whom the donor is compatible. Some people question if this is fair to donors who have no one able or willing to donate a kidney on their behalf. |
